One of the most alarming and recurrent issues in the Kannada film industry is the exploitation of aspiring actresses by powerful figures. Many cases involve individuals in positions of authority who use job offers as a pretext for sexual harassment, fraud, and blackmail. A prominent example is the case of Hemanth Kumar, a multi-faceted figure—actor, director, and producer—who was arrested in Bengaluru in October 2025 on serious charges of sexually harassing an actress and blackmailing her using private photos. According to the police complaint, Kumar met the actress in 2022 and offered her a lead role in his film Richie . It is alleged that during a promotional event in Mumbai, he spiked her drink with liquor; after she lost consciousness, he took private photos and videos of her and subsequently used them to coerce her into performing indecent scenes. The actress further claimed that Kumar pressured her to wear revealing clothes and even sent goons to threaten her and her mother when she resisted. This case is chillingly similar to another involving television actor Charith Balappa, who was also arrested for sexually harassing an actress and threatening to leak her private content.
